The Seattle Seahawks head into their Thursday Night Football matchup against the Arizona Cardinals fresh off their most dominant win of the season.
The Seahawks destroyed the New Orleans Saints 44-13 in Week 3, during which quarterback Sam Darnold completed 14-of-18 passes for 218 yards and two touchdowns. His passer rating of 154.2 was close to a perfect 158.3.
Following his “near flawless” performance against New Orleans, as Pro Football Focus described it, Darnold enters Week 4 with the highest overall grade among quarterbacks (91.9). It’s safe to say that Darnold, who signed a three-year, $100.5 million contract with Seattle this offseason, is surpassing expectations thus far.
With the Seahawks sitting at 2-1 on the season, a win over their NFC West rival, the Cardinals, who are also 2-1, would be huge. Cheering on Seattle as they travel to State Farm Field in Glendale on September 25, Darnold’s fiancée, Katie Hoofnagle.
Darnold, who’s dated Hoofnagle since 2023, proposed in July. The couple immediately celebrated with an engagement party in Dana Point, California, with guests that included Buffalo Bills quarterback Josh Allen and his wife, Hailee Steinfeld.

Sam Darnold Is Confident The Seahawks’ Offense Is Only Going To Get Better
While the Seahawks are on a short week, Darnold is confident that the offense will continue to improve as the season progresses. “It’s just continuing to know each other, to learn each other in the system, watch the tape, and be able to learn from Sunday,” Darnold told reporters.
“What do we do on Monday to get better from it and continue that process with each other. I think that’s the biggest thing and communicating. The more that we communicate with each other, the more that we talk to the coaches about what we’re seeing on the field, and how we can just clean things up as a group. It’s only going to continue to help us in the future and we’re going to continue to do that.”
